On the road to Emmaus, after talking with Jesus, the two disciples looked at each other and proclaimed: "Did not our heart burn within us while He talked with us on the road, and while He opened the Scriptures to us?"
There is something powerful when you allow God to reveal truth to you through His Word. We are told that the Word of God is living and active, and when we study it, it is not like studying Shakespeare but rather spending time with the Author Himself.
Every Christian should seek to experience "heart burn" as we spend time in the Bible.
